Output 58c3c5ffd2af9ffe06ce54a87f3afb4bfd24d6ffa0e3aed998afbecf340b1e0e:0

value
1891505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 833f091185e73f02cf6200f3fbfb35c48f560819 OP_EQUAL
address
3DeyxT9HWvSFxdKjCfDjMnRwWFyZphNFCA
transaction
58c3c5ffd2af9ffe06ce54a87f3afb4bfd24d6ffa0e3aed998afbecf340b1e0e
spent
true